In most cases, this pathology is diagnosed late, which leads to the development of severe deformities of the foot, up to the loss of support ability of the limb. There is no single hypothesis for the formation of Charcot’s foot, but there are factors predisposing to its development, as well as a few likely provoking events. Excessive formation and accumulation of end products of glycation may play an important role in the pathogenesis of this complication of diabetes. End products of glycation (AGE) are a variety of compounds formed as a result of a non-enzymatic reaction between carbohydrates and free amino groups of proteins, lipids and nucleic acids. There are various factors that lead to the accumulation of AGE in the human body. Allocate endogenous and exogenous factors. The former include certain diseases, such as diabetes mellitus, renal failure, which accelerate glycation processes. Exogenous factors leading to the formation of lipo-oxidation and glyco-oxidation products include tobacco smoke and prolonged heat treatment of food.</p><p>This review provides information on the role of glycation end products in the development and progression of complications in patients with diabetes mellitus.</p></trans-abstract><kwd-group xml:lang="ru"><kwd>сахарный диабет</kwd><kwd>стопа Шарко</kwd><kwd>ДНОАП</kwd><kwd>остеоартропатия</kwd><kwd>конечные продукты гликирования</kwd></kwd-group><kwd-group xml:lang="en"><kwd>diabetes mellitus</kwd><kwd>Charcot foot</kwd><kwd>DNOAP</kwd><kwd>osteoarthropathy</kwd><kwd>advanced glycation end products</kwd></kwd-group></article-meta></front><back><ref-list><ref id="cit1"><element-citation><name><surname>Cho</surname> <given-names>N.H.</given-names> </name> <name><surname>Shaw</surname> <given-names>J.E.</given-names> </name> <name><surname>Karuranga</surname> <given-names>S.</given-names> </name> <name><surname>Huang</surname> <given-names>Y.</given-names> </name> <name><surname>da Rocha Fernandes</surname> <given-names>J.D.</given-names> </name> <name><surname>Ohlrogge</surname> <given-names>A.W.</given-names> </name> <name><surname>Malanda</surname> <given-names>B.</given-names> </name> <article-title>IDF Diabetes Atlas: Global estimates of diabetes prevalence for 2017 and projections for 2045</article-title> <source>Diabetes Research and Clinical Practice</source> <year>2018</year> <month>02</month> <fpage>271</fpage> <lpage>281</lpage> <volume>138</volume> <object-id pub-id-type="doi" specific-use="metadata">10.1016/j.diabres.2018.02.023</object-id></element-citation></ref><ref id="cit2"><mixed-citation publication-type="commun" publication-format="web"><name><surname>Tokmakova</surname> <given-names>A.Yu.</given-names></name>, <name><surname>Doronina</surname> <given-names>L.P.</given-names></name>, <name><surname>Galstyan</surname> <given-names>G.R.</given-names></name>, <name><surname>Senyushkina</surname> <given-names>E.S.</given-names></name>, <name><surname>Mitish</surname> <given-names>V.A.</given-names></name> <article-title>Otdalennye rezul'taty kompleksnoi terapii bol'noi sakharnym diabetom 2 tipa i dvustoronnei neiroosteoartropatiei</article-title>. <source>Rany i ranevye infektsii</source> // Zhurnal im. prof.
